Add FLATBUFFERS_COMPATIBILITY string (#5381)

* Add FLATBUFFERS_COMPATIBILITY string

- Add a new __reset method NET/JAVA which hides internal state

* Resolve PR notes

* Use operator new() to __init of Struct and Table

* Restrict visibility of C# Table/Struct to internal level
